What They Do
Forta Health provides virtual applied behavior analysis (ABA) therapy for children with autism, built around licensed clinical oversight, home-based sessions, and active caregiver participation. The company’s model uses AI and workflow tooling to support clinicians and families while shifting more therapy into the natural home environment instead of relying on clinic-heavy staffing. Forta contracts with major health insurers and state programs, making reimbursement rather than direct consumer payment the center of its model. That payer-backed structure matters because Forta’s core pitch is not convenience alone, but solving severe access shortages in autism care deserts.
Competitive Position
Forta competes with clinic-based ABA providers and newer virtual autism therapy companies, but its clearest differentiator is that it was built virtual-first rather than adapting a clinic model to telehealth later. That gives it stronger reach into care deserts and Medicaid-heavy geographies, though it also places more weight on caregiver engagement than traditional center-based models. Compared with broader pediatric behavioral health companies, Forta is narrower in scope but more specialized in autism workflow, reimbursement, and outcomes measurement.
